Leasowes Miniature Railway is a 7¼" gauge single track line running for approximately 400 yards along the towpath of Dudley No 2 canal, with views overlooking woodland and Breaches Pool. It is owned and operated by ex BR fireman M.J. Male, who laid the original track in the summer of 1990. The railway operates every Sunday and Bank Holiday throughout the year if weather permits. Motive power is either by steam loco "Prince Edward", or the diesel loco "William Shenstone". Car park and children's play area nearby. Website www.leasowses.bravehost.com
